`
linhui_dragon
  • 浏览: 149504 次
  • 性别: Icon_minigender_2
  • 来自: 北京
社区版块
存档分类
最新评论
文章列表
html5 在IE6/IE7/IE8中使用html5标签 html5出来后多了很多标签,但是IE6/IE7/IE8并不支持html5,这让我们开发html5网站的很郁闷。现在就介绍下如何在IE6/IE7/IE8中使用html5标签。 原理就是在css中,将新标签的样式变成块状元素,然后在script中创建新标签。直接放出代码,如果您是IE6/IE7/IE8用户,可运行代码试试: <!doctype html><head> <meta http-equiv="Content-Type" content="text/html; ...
让IE浏览器支持HTML5标准的方法 自HTML5标准的提出就得到非常多的关注,而作为全球使用用户最多的IE浏览器能够支持HTML5标准也是大家备受关注一个问题,上周微软在技术大会上就表示目前微软正在开发的IE9将更加支持HTML5标准 ...

网站重构

 
网站重构 前不久听到这样一个面试的故事: 面试官:你准备在我们公司做些什么事情?(大致这个意思) 面试人:我准备在公司做网站重构,把原来是table的页面全部重构成css+div的,... 面试官:不好意思,我们的网站都是css+ ...
jquery设置元素的readonly和disabled Jquery的api中提供了对元素应用disabled和readonly属性的方法,在这里记录下。如下: 1.readonly$('input').attr("readonly","readonly")//将input元素设置为readonly   $('input').removeAttr("readonly");//去除input元素的readonly属性    if($('input').attr("readonly")==tr ...

JS数据类型转换

    博客分类:
  • JS
JS数据类型转换 JS数据类型转换方法主要有三种:转换函数、强制类型转换、利用js变量弱类型转换。 1、转换函数: js提供了parseInt()和parseFloat()两个转换函数。前者把值转换成整数,后者把值转换成浮点数。只有对String类型调用这些方法,这两个函数才能正确运行;对其他类型返回的都是NaN(Not a Number)。 在判断字符串是事是数字值前,parseInt()和parseFloat()都会仔细分析该字符串。parseInt()方法首先查看位置0处的字符,判断它是否是个有效数字;如果不是,该方法返回NaN,不再继续执行其他操作。如果该字符是有效数字,该方法 ...

window.onload

    博客分类:
  • JS
window.onload 简单地讲,window.onload和<body onload="">可以理解成一个,只要有一个就行了,不要同时使用,同时使用的话,在程序能正常运作的情况下,以最后出现的为准; window.onload的正确用法是【window.onload=function(){ ...

JS:window.onload的使用

    博客分类:
  • JS
JS:window.onload的使用 1、最简单的调用方式    直接写到html的body标签里面,如:   <html> <body onload="func()"> </body> </html> 2、在JS语句调用    <script type="text/javascript"> function func(){……} window.onload=func; </sc ...
Jquery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,不过与window.onload方法还是有区别的。 1.执行时间         window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行。         $(document).ready() ...
HTML5 的 PLACEHOLDER 属性\ HTML5对Web Form做了许多增强,比如input新增的type类型、Form Validation等。Placeholder是HTML5新增的另一个属性,当input或者textarea设置了该属性后,该值的内容将作为灰字提示显示在文本框中,当文本框获得焦点时,提示文字消失。以前要实现这效果都是用JavaScript来控制才能实现: function hasPlaceholderSupport() { return 'placeholder' in document.createElement('input'); } ...
通过css zoom缩放,兼容Firefox IE浏览器和新版chrome都支持css的zoom属性,这个属性用于缩放节点,取值0到1,例: zoom: 0.5; 但是目前为止firefox不支持该属性,可以通过下面两个属性实现: -moz-transform,-moz-transform-origin -moz-transform可用于缩放节点,它还有其他功能,暂不讨论,用于缩放的写法如下: -moz-transform:scale(0.5); 但是它会缩放到中间,而IE会缩放到左上角,再通过-moz-transform-origin:top left;就可以实现和IE一样的效 ...

JSON 数据格式

    博客分类:
  • JS
JSON 数据格式 J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式。JSON采用完全独立于语言的文本格式,这些特性使JSON成为理想的数据交换语言。易于人阅读和编写,同时也易于机器解析和生成。 基础结构 JSON建构于两种结构: 1. “名称/值”对的集合(A collection of name/value pairs)。不同的语言中,它被理解为对象(object),记录(record),结构(struct),字典(dictionary),哈希表(hash table),有键列表(keyed list),或者关联数组 (associative ...
Html 5中自定义data-*特性 Html 5中支持用户自定义的data-*特性,它们在UI是不可见的。例如data-length,它可以附加在input的标签上。更加具体信息可参考W3C Html 5 data-说明书 有这么一段描述: Custom data attributes are intended to store custom data private to the page or application, for which there are no more appropriate attributes or elements. 接下来我们就可以实现这样一个简单例子 ...
http://www.cnblogs.com/2050/archive/2012/08/13/2636467.html CSS布局奇淫巧计之-强大的负边距
js 中  map 转换 json 格式 function setValue() { var jsonData = document.getElementById("jsonData").value; var json = eval("("+jsonData+")"); for (var o in json) { var names = document.getElementsByName(o); var tagname = names[0].tagName; if ("INPUT" == tagna ...
JS获取当前页面的URL信息 设置或获取对象指定的文件名或路径。 <script> alert(window.location.pathname) </script> 设置或获取整个 URL 为字符串。 <script> alert(window.location.href); </script> 设置或获取与 URL 关联的端口 ...
Global site tag (gtag.js) - Google Analytics